2008 U.S. National Spear Fishing Championships
Thursday, August 21st, 2008The 2008 US National Spear Fishing Championships were held on August 7th, in Newport, Rhode Island. The event, while based in RI, was run by the Mass Freedivers who, for the first time, played host to the sports most anticipated tournament. Over 60 of spearfishings elite made the trip to Rhode Island in hopes of becoming this years Champs.
The MA Freedivers would like to congratulate this years winning divers. Sean Moreschi, John Modica and Michael Marino (representing Palm Beach) took home the mens title while Kimi Werner and Andrew Tamasese (Alli Holo Kai) left their mark on the mixed division. Kimi also took home the overall crown for the woman as well as the biggest fish with a fat 33lb Striper. Local assassin Justin Allen (MA Freedivers) edged out Dan Silveria (cen-cal) for the mens title. Andrew Geist (MA Freedivers) brought in the largest fish overall in the form of a 45lb bass.
Thank you to all who made the trip and congras to the new Champs.
